Rapper and business mogul Jay-Z is about to become an author. Publisher Spiegel & Grau will release “Decoded,” a 336-page memoir, on Nov. 16.
Unlike traditional memoirs, Rolling Stone reports, Jay-Z’s book will also include interviews with family and friends. The book was co-written by Dream Hampton, a former editor at the Source.
According to the report, much of the material for the book was compiled three years ago, but Jay-Z was reluctant to see its release. What’s changed? Maybe Jay-Z figures that if Justin Bieber has a memoir, so can he.
